“Decent Courtyard, nothing special”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ed 13 April 2010

There are many great Courtyards out there with plush bedding, nice paint and pictures on the walls, and generally comfy and nice furniture. This is not one of them.

Although this is a fine Courtyard, it's more like a downgraded Fairfield to me. (Speaking of the Fairfield next door, that's even worse). The bed was trampoline-like, but was okay. The pillows were horrific. Imagine a bag of cotton balls in your pillow. Now imagine that someone removed half the cotton balls exactly where your head should be. Add one more image of knowing that every single pillow in your room is identical. For me, this was a big issue because I slept terribly because I just wasn't comfortable. For you, it might be fine.

There are positive features of the hotel: Breakfast buffet in the lobby (for a cost). Hotel is very quiet (unless your screen rattles in the wind like mine did). Location is also quite nice, especially if you don't have a car. You can walk about 100 yards to an Outback, Jason's Deli, or Applebee's. You can walk about 1-2 blocks to a Walmart, essentially next door.

I have not found a great hotel yet in Lubbock for business. The Courtyard sure doesn't win any awards, so I might keep looking. Hopefully it's in line for a renovation in the near future (and the Fairfield too).

“Clean, but not service oriented”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ed 23 September 2008

Came here on a business trip, and try to stay at Courtyards whenever I can. This is a decent and very clean Courtyard, that has not been upgraded to the new renovated rooms. However, the furniture, bed, and other aspects of the room are in good shape. I was very happy with both the room, and the location (can walk to 4 good restaurants - Outback, Cheddar, Jason's Deli and IHOP - as well as a Wal-Mart, and good freeway access). But was very disappointed in the service. I arrived at 4PM but had to wait 1 hour for a room - no apologies. Front desk clerk was not around and found out he was taking care of his 2 year old daughter rather than manning the desk. There were no evening cookies or morning paper for all three weekdays of my stay, as is typical of other Courtyards. I just think they are lax here about service and have a lot of young people who don't care manning the front desk. Not sure if I would return or not - would need to check out some other places in the area first.

“The YUCK factor killed it. Grossed me out!”
1 of 5 stars Reviewed 29 June 2008
1
person found this review helpful

I almost gave this hotel the Okay, but some problems rating. There were four things that I consider major problems -

1) When I lifted the toilet seat, there was massive poop splash back under the seat! YUCK!!! YUCK!!! YUCK!!!

2) It was 98 degrees and the air conditioning could not keep up. The room was about 85 degrees. At about 2 am it would cool down. By 7 am it was back in the 80's.

3) The internet connection went down on my second day there and never came back up.

4) Very poor breakfast selection. The bananas were black as soot. Why would they leave bananas out there that looked like that? They must have been two or three weeks old.

This is a good location. There are restaurants galore within a mile. Or, you can simply walk to one across the parking lot. The room was reasonably quiet.

The toilet seat adventure absolutely grossed me out!
